DevOps Lead

4 weeks ago


Vancouver, Canada Royal Bank of Canada Full time

Job Summary

Job Description

What is the opportunity?

As the Salesforce DevOps Lead & Release Manager within Wealth Management Canada (WMC), you will have a critical leadership role in the implementation and management of Salesforce Financial Services Cloud (FSC) as the core WMC CRM platform, providing technical leadership into the overall solution design that accounts for how key CRM internal aspects need to be setup, as well as integration points and processes to implement the functional capabilities needed for CRM to transform RBC WMC’s ability to engage with clients and derive key data driven analytics.

You’ll be leading a diverse and inclusive agile lab across multiple programs that deliver solutions on Salesforce FSC and Lighting platform, along with critical Kafka (Java) development for near real-time data integrations between Salesforce and downstream producers/consumers.

The successful candidate will be excited to join and lead a team that employs the latest in Salesforce technology, scaled agile practices, as well as DevOps/SRE to stand up an infrastructure that supports the Salesforce Platform for RBC WMC.

What will you do?

  • Lead, manage and own the DevOps pipeline and process efficiencies, advocating for developer productivity.
  • Design the environment strategy and lead the development teams to the correct branching strategy based on the release goals of our program.
  • Act as a release manager, approving configuration and coded items to be deployed between environments. Where appropriate, this could include deploying changes.
  • Continuously raise our standard of engineering excellence by implementing standard processes for coding, testing, and deployment.
  • Stay current on Salesforce’s development platform and implement Salesforce development best practices, following the RBC internal standards and guidelines.
  • Experience in building and enhancing CICD pipelines and tools to deploy Salesforce Packages (e.g., Flosum, Gearset, Jenkins, Copado).
  • Design process/schedule to deliver completed development to various environments.
  • Design and write build scripts.
  • Verify successful continuous delivery deployments.
  • Maintain a version control repository.
  • Design a comprehensive branching structure that fits the needs of a delivery team with parallel major and minor releases.
  • Coordinate releases to our production environment with our Production Support Team.
  • Review continuous delivery validation builds for failures.
  • Move development and configuration work between version control branches.
  • Resolve deployment issues with development and configuration teams.

What do you need to succeed?

Must-have

  • A minimum of 8 years of related or equivalent experience.
  • Proven experience managing system changes without interruption to the user.
  • Experience working with Agile methodology.
  • Familiarity with Continuous Integration tools such as source control, and automation.
  • Strong communication skills.
  • Hands-on experience with Continuous Integration/Continuous Delivery tools such as Jenkins, Github Actions, Urban Code Deploy.
  • Experience integrating DevOps pipelines with code scanning tools such as Checkmarx.
  • Experience using DevOps tools such as Flosum, GearSet and Copado.
  • Salesforce Certifications: Salesforce Administrator.

Nice-to-have

  • Experience implementing CRM solutions in the financial sector.
  • Flosum Professional Certification.
  • Flosum Expert Certification.

RBC is committed to supporting flexible work arrangements when and where available. Details to be discussed with Hiring Manager.

What’s in it for you?

  • A comprehensive Total Rewards Program including bonuses and flexible benefits, competitive compensation, commissions, and stock where applicable.
  • Leaders who support your development through coaching and managing opportunities.
  • Ability to make a difference and lasting impact.
  • Work in a dynamic, collaborative, progressive, and high-performing team.
  • A world-class training program in financial services.
  • Flexible work/life balance options.
  • Opportunities to do challenging work.
  • Opportunities to take on progressively greater accountabilities.
  • Opportunities to build close relationships with clients.
  • Access to a variety of job opportunities across business and geographies.

Job Skills

Application Development, Application Integrations, Application Maintenance, Applications Architecture, Commercial Acumen, Enterprise Application Delivery, Information Technology Management, Programming Languages, Software Development Life Cycle (SDLC), System Applications.

Inclusion and Equal Opportunity Employment

At RBC, we embrace diversity and inclusion for innovation and growth. We are committed to building inclusive teams and an equitable workplace for our employees to bring their true selves to work. We are taking actions to tackle issues of inequity and systemic bias to support our diverse talent, clients, and communities.

We also strive to provide an accessible candidate experience for our prospective employees with different abilities. Please let us know if you need any accommodations during the recruitment process.

Join our Talent Community

Stay in-the-know about great career opportunities at RBC. Sign up and get customized info on our latest jobs, career tips, and Recruitment events that matter to you. Expand your limits and create a new future together at RBC. Find out how we use our passion and drive to enhance the well-being of our clients and communities at jobs.rbc.com.

#J-18808-Ljbffr
  • DevOps Team Lead

    4 weeks ago


    Vancouver, British Columbia, Canada Promote Project Full time

    Transform Your Career with Our DevOps Team Lead OpportunityCopperleaf is a world-class organization that inspires innovation and growth. We're seeking an experienced DevOps Team Lead to join our team and drive organizational changes related to DevOps. As a DevOps Team Lead, you will be responsible for optimizing the flow of delivery, improving the...

  • DevOps Team Lead

    1 month ago


    Vancouver, British Columbia, Canada Team Charter Full time

    About the RoleWe are seeking a highly skilled DevOps Team Lead to join our team at Copperleaf. As a key member of our DevOps team, you will be responsible for leading the development and implementation of our cloud native applications, ensuring the reliability and scalability of our infrastructure, and driving organizational changes related to DevOps.Key...

  • Lead DevOps Engineer

    2 weeks ago


    Vancouver, Canada Randstad Canada Full time

    Are you an experienced DevOps Engineer in search of your next contract opportunity? Our high-profile client is seeking to hire a Lead DevOps Engineer to join their talented team on a 6-month contract with a strong probability of extension. Apply for this amazing opportunity if this sounds like a good fit for you!AdvantagesWhat’s in it for you!As a...

  • DevOps Lead

    3 weeks ago


    Vancouver, British Columbia, Canada Royal Bank of Canada Full time

    About the RoleThe Royal Bank of Canada is seeking an experienced DevOps Lead - Salesforce to join our team. As a key member of our Agile Lab, you will be responsible for leading and managing the DevOps pipeline and process efficiencies, advocating for developer productivity.Key ResponsibilitiesLead and manage the DevOps pipeline and process...

  • DevOps Lead

    5 months ago


    Vancouver, Canada Bosa Properties Full time

    About The Company: Bosa Properties Inc. (“BPI”) is an end-to-end real estate company offering human-centered solutions for property development and management. Based out of Vancouver, Canada, our team of in-house experts work across residential, commercial and master-planned projects, with a growing residential portfolio that includes more than 22,000...

  • DevOps Team Lead

    4 months ago


    Vancouver, Canada Promote Project Full time

    DevOps Team LeadLocation: Vancouver, RemoteCopperleaf’s enterprise software helps some of the world’s largest firms make better strategic decisions. We have a track record of delivering award-winning, industry-changing solutions that enable our clients to operationalize their ESG and sustainability strategies. Our solutions empower them to build optimal...


  • Vancouver, British Columbia, Canada Royal Bank of Canada Full time

    Job SummaryJob DescriptionWhat is the opportunity?As the Salesforce DevOps Lead & Release Manager within Royal Bank of Canada, you will have a critical leadership role in the implementation and management of Salesforce Financial Services Cloud (FSC) as the core CRM platform, providing technical leadership into the overall solution design that accounts for...

  • DevOps Engineer

    1 month ago


    Vancouver, British Columbia, Canada Randstad Full time

    DevOps Engineer OpportunityAre you a skilled DevOps Engineer looking for a new challenge? Our client, a leading organization, is seeking a talented individual to join their team on a 6-month contract with a strong possibility of extension.What's in it for you?Competitive hourly ratesA 6-month contract with a strong possibility of extensionAs a consultant...

  • DevOps Team Lead

    1 month ago


    Vancouver, British Columbia, Canada Promote Project Full time

    DevOps Team Lead - Cloud Native ApplicationsCopperleaf's enterprise software helps some of the world's largest firms make better strategic decisions. We have a track record of delivering award-winning, industry-changing solutions that enable our clients to operationalize their ESG and sustainability strategies.The DevOps team is focused on optimizing the...


  • Vancouver, British Columbia, Canada Randstad Full time

    About the OpportunityWe are seeking a highly skilled Senior DevOps Technical Lead to join our client's talented team on a 6-month contract with a strong probability of extension. This is an exceptional opportunity for experienced professionals looking to take their career to the next level.Key ResponsibilitiesLeverage your technical expertise to lead and...

  • DevOps Director

    1 week ago


    Vancouver, British Columbia, Canada Electronic Arts Full time

    Job OverviewWe are seeking a highly skilled DevOps Director to lead our strategic project team.About the RoleManage a team of DevOps engineers, working collaboratively as part of a global team.Work with tech leads and engineers on planning and implementing strategic DevOps projects, ensuring seamless execution and high-quality results.Guide project planning,...

  • DevOps Engineer

    1 month ago


    Vancouver, British Columbia, Canada Incognito Software Systems Full time

    Job SummaryWe are seeking a highly skilled DevOps Engineer to join our team at Incognito Software Systems. As a DevOps Engineer, you will be responsible for designing, implementing, and maintaining automated build and deployment pipelines for our software applications.Key ResponsibilitiesLead and collaborate with development teams to integrate DevOps...

  • DevOps Engineer

    4 weeks ago


    Vancouver, British Columbia, Canada Incognito Software Systems Full time

    Job SummaryIncognito Software Systems is seeking a highly skilled DevOps Engineer to join our team. As a DevOps Engineer, you will be responsible for designing, implementing, and maintaining automated build and deployment pipelines for both new and existing applications.Key ResponsibilitiesLead and collaborate with development teams to integrate DevOps...


  • Vancouver, Canada Royal Bank of Canada Full time

    Job Summary Job Description What is the opportunity? As the Salesforce DevOps Lead & Release Manager within Wealth Management Canada (WMC), you will have a critical leadership role in the implementation and management of Salesforce Financial Services Cloud (FSC) as the core WMC CRM platform, providing technical leadership into the overall solution design...

  • DevOps Engineer

    1 month ago


    Vancouver, British Columbia, Canada Electronic Arts Full time

    Job SummaryWe are seeking a highly skilled DevOps Engineer to join our team at Electronic Arts. As a DevOps Engineer, you will be responsible for designing, implementing, and maintaining our cloud infrastructure, ensuring seamless deployment and operation of our services.ResponsibilitiesDesign and implement cloud infrastructure solutions using public cloud...


  • Vancouver, British Columbia, Canada Randstad Canada Full time

    About the RoleWe are seeking a highly skilled Senior DevOps Engineer to join our team at Randstad Canada. As a senior member of our engineering team, you will play a key role in designing and implementing scalable, secure, and reliable software systems.Job SummaryThis is an exciting opportunity for a seasoned DevOps professional to lead our cloud engineering...

  • DevOps Engineer

    2 weeks ago


    Vancouver, British Columbia, Canada Market Jar Media Inc. Full time

    Market Jar Media Inc. is currently seeking a skilled DevOps Engineer to lead and coordinate teams in the development and implementation of software and integrated information systems. The ideal candidate will have a Master's degree and at least 5 years of experience in software development and IT infrastructure management.Key Responsibilities:Lead and...

  • DevOps Engineer

    1 month ago


    Vancouver, British Columbia, Canada T-Net British Columbia Full time

    DevOps Engineer (Linux)Global Relay Communications Inc.About Us:Global Relay is a leading provider of cloud-based information archiving solutions for the financial industry.Your Role:We are seeking a highly skilled DevOps Engineer to join our team. As a DevOps Engineer, you will be responsible for ensuring the reliability and smooth operation of our services...

  • DevOps Engineer

    3 months ago


    Vancouver, Canada Electronic Arts Inc Full time

    Requisition Number: 185416 Position Title: DevOps Engineer II External Description: EA SPORTS is one of the most iconic brands in entertainment - connecting hundreds of millions around the world to the sports they love through a portfolio of industry-leading video games. The DevOps team is looki

  • DevOps Engineer

    2 months ago


    Vancouver, Canada Electronic Arts Inc Full time

    Requisition Number: 181915 Position Title: DevOps Engineer III External Description: EA SPORTS is one of the most iconic brands in entertainment - connecting hundreds of millions around the world to the sports they love through a portfolio of industry-leading video games. The DevOps team is look